Hi, I am using sylenth with cubase and wondered if there was any way to

A) save all my favourite presets to a single bank (there are so many great presets) in order to make it easier to access them without loading individual banks one at a time

B) save all the individual banks to one big bank

Any help would be greatly appreciated

dj_jonesy wrote:A) save all my favourite presets to a single bank (there are so many great presets) in order to make it easier to access them without loading individual banks one
You can save the individual presets in one folder on your harddrive using the preset-saving functionality in Cubase. After that you can load them all in a new bank and save the whole bank. You should be able to find more info about loading/saving presets and banks in the Cubase manual.
dj_jonesy wrote:B) save all the individual banks to one big bank
The banks are currently limited to 128 presets, but there will be an onboard preset browser in a future update that will have easier access and larger banks.
